After undergoing a butt lift in Perth, patients can anticipate a transformative experience that enhances both the shape and size of their buttocks. The procedure typically involves the removal of excess skin and fat, followed by the redistribution of fat to create a more aesthetically pleasing contour.
Immediately post-surgery, patients may experience some discomfort, swelling, and bruising, which are normal and expected reactions to the procedure. Pain management strategies, including prescribed medications, will help alleviate these symptoms. It is crucial to follow the surgeon's post-operative care instructions diligently to ensure proper healing and optimal results.
During the initial recovery period, which usually lasts for a few weeks, patients should avoid sitting directly on their buttocks to prevent pressure on the surgical site. Instead, they can use a special cushion designed to distribute weight evenly. Strenuous activities and heavy lifting should be avoided for at least six weeks to allow the body to heal properly.
As the healing progresses, patients will notice gradual improvements in the appearance of their buttocks. The final results of the butt lift can be fully appreciated after all swelling has subsided, typically within a few months. The enhanced shape and contour achieved through the procedure can provide a significant boost in confidence and self-esteem.
It is important to maintain a healthy lifestyle, including regular exercise and a balanced diet, to preserve the results of the butt lift. Follow-up appointments with the surgeon will be scheduled to monitor the healing process and address any concerns that may arise. Overall, the experience of a butt lift in Perth can lead to a more attractive and proportionate figure, contributing to a positive body image and improved quality of life.
